About The Position

The Cyber Threat Hunt Analyst plays a crucial role in enhancing the security posture of the organization by proactively identifying and mitigating advanced cyber threats. This position involves conducting threat hunting activities, analyzing threat intelligence, and collaborating with team members to respond to security incidents, thereby contributing to national security efforts.

Responsibilities

  • Proactively conduct threat hunting activities to detect advanced threats that evade traditional security solutions.
  • Continuously monitor and analyze threat intelligence sources to stay informed about emerging threats.
  • Search for signs of malicious activity in the network and systems.
  • Develop and implement new and innovative threat detection techniques and strategies.
  • Analyze large datasets to identify patterns and anomalies indicative of malicious activities.
  • Collaborate with other CSOC team members and stakeholders to respond to and investigate security incidents.
  • Provide detailed reports and briefings on threat hunting activities and findings to senior management.
  • Develop and maintain threat hunting playbooks, processes, and procedures.
  • Perform in-depth forensic analysis to understand the nature and impact of threats.
  • Participate in the development and refinement of security monitoring and incident response tools and processes.
